A. Morton Thomas and Associates, Inc. (AMT) is seeking a Civil Engineering Project Manager with 6-12 years of experience for a position in our Rockville, MD office. Working in one of AMT’s regional offices such as Towson, MD or Herndon, VA will be considered on a case-by-case basis. AMT will provide the flexibility and necessary equipment to work from home 1 to 2 days per week, as agreed upon with the Site and Infrastructure Group Leader. The ideal candidate is desired to work in the office on a full-time basis.

 

You’ll find success in this position if you:

·          Have strong time management skills and the ability to balance and prioritize multiple projects

·          Can identify and resolve project risks and design challenges   

·          Enjoy building and motivating teams

·          Have strong written and oral communication skills

·          Enjoy interfacing with clients

\n


Responsibilities
  • Leading multi-discipline teams to deliver quality land development and civil engineering design projects
  • Serving as liaison between client and project team including external stakeholder agencies
  • Managing all technical resources on the project team including subconsultants
  • Preparing task proposals and establish project pricing and budgets
  • Developing project management plans for assigned projects and preparing monthly progress reports
  • Developing and maintaining project schedules
  • Leading or participating in client meetings and presentations
  • Providing quality control reviews of submittals and deliverables
  • Mentoring and training junior staff
  • Assisting with production tasks (CADD drawings, reports, graphics / renderings, etc.)
  • Assisting Group Leader and Division Directors with business development and proposals
  • Maintaining a positive working relationships with co-workers, project managers, supervisors, and other team members


Qualifications
  • Professional Engineer (PE) in Maryland, Virginia, or Washington DC Required
  • 6 to 12 years experience in the planning and civil engineering design of commercial, institutional, federal, military, and public site development projects
  • Bachelor's degree in Civil Engineering
  • Ability to prepare plans, specifications and cost estimates
  • Proficiency with industry standard software such as StormCAD, HyroCAD, Hydroflow, FlowMaster, and others
  • Highly skilled in Microsoft Word, Excel, Project, and BlueBeam
  • Ability to assist with the preparation of engineering studies and reports
  • Proficiency with AutoCAD/Civil 3D
  • Strong written and oral communication skills
